Landscape grading and resloping involve reshaping the surface to improve drain, prevent disintegration, and create aesthetically enticing outdoor spaces. Correct grading directs water away from structures, reduces pooling, and supports healthy plant growth. The procedure begins with evaluating the existing topography, soil type, and desired water flow. Heavy machinery or hand grading may be used to adjust slopes, level areas for lawns, and create functional spaces such as balconies or walkways. Resloping likewise supports long-lasting landscape health by preventing soil disintegration, decreasing stress on plants, and keeping proper drain. Well-executed grading guarantees structural stability, enhances visual appeal, and secures the property from water-related damage
